Greene, Graham - a Sort of Life - First Edition - Presentation Copy

About the Item

Author: Greene, Graham. Title: A Sort of Life. Publisher: London: The Bodley Head, 1971. Description: first edition presentation copy. 1 vol., inscribed on the front blank endleaf "For George Barker with good wishes Graham Greene", bound in the publisher's original green cloth, with the DJ, not price clipped. Condition: VG/VG. ADDITIONAL INFORMATION: A scarce title signed. The recipient George Barker (1913-1991) was a poet. Greene was a long time admirer of Barker's work and even provided financial assistance to help him purchase a house. This item comes with a "COA" - Certificate of Authenticity
